Great ride, Had a couple of times with rain where the Omarama Saddle has been serious, I would want to have a partner for that bit.
Thompson Gorge road from Omakau to Tarras is an alternative, a few gates but a good ride.
Like your choice of taking the WR, Hope you have a big tank or extra fuel, couple of long runs without gas stations.

Glad to hear you had a good ride, sounds like fun.

Mileage wise, I start getting nervous at 160K, but have nursed it to 180, it took 6.7ltr to fill it back up.
Have just fitted a IMS 12ltr tank, still waiting to see when the light comes on.
I also have a carrier for an extra 4ltrs
Should get me into the mid/high 300k range.
Mavora road is cool, Nevis can alter with conditions, lots of water crossings.
